nand_dt_init() is still using fdtdec_xx() interface.
If OF_LIVE flag is enabled, dt property can't be get anymore.
Updating all fdtdec_xx() interface to ofnode_xx() to solve this issue.
For doing this, node parameter type must be ofnode.
First idea was to convert "node" parameter to ofnode type inside
nand_dt_init() using offset_to_ofnode(node). But offset_to_ofnode()
is not bijective, in case OF_LIVE flag is enabled, it performs an assert().
So, this leads to update nand_chip struct flash_node field from int to
ofnode and to update all nand_dt_init() callers.

Force the mtd name of spi-nor to "nor" + the driver sequence number:
"nor0", "nor1"... beginning after the existing nor devices.
This patch is coherent with existing "nand" and "spi-nand"
mtd device names.
When CFI MTD NOR device are supported, the spi-nor index is chosen after
the last CFI device defined by CONFIG_SYS_MAX_FLASH_BANKS.
When CONFIG_SYS_MAX_FLASH_BANKS_DETECT is activated, this config
is replaced by to cfi_flash_num_flash_banks in the include file
mtd/cfi_flash.h.
This generic name "nor%d" can be use to identify the mtd spi-nor device
without knowing the real device name or the DT path of the device,
used with API get_mtd_device_nm() and is used in mtdparts command.

TCG EFI Protocol Specification defines the number_of_algorithms
field in spec ID event to be equal to the number of active
algorithms supported by the TPM device. In current implementation,
this field is populated with the count of all algorithms supported
by the TPM which leads to incorrect spec ID event creation.
Similarly, the algorithm array in spec ID event should be a variable
length array with length being equal to the number_of_algorithms field.
In current implementation this is defined as a fixed length array
which has been fixed.

Resetting an XHCI controller inside xhci_register undoes any register
setup performed by the platform driver. And at least on the Allwinner
H6, resetting the XHCI controller also resets the PHY, which prevents
the controller from working. That means the controller must be taken out
of reset before initializing the PHY, which must be done before calling
xhci_register.
The logic in the XHCI core was added to support the Raspberry Pi 4
(although this was not mentioned in the commit log!), which uses the
xhci-pci platform driver. Move the reset logic to the platform driver,
where it belongs, and where it cannot interfere with other platform
drivers.
This also fixes a failure to call reset_free if xhci_register failed.

The K3 SoCs have some PLL output clocks (POSTDIV clocks) which in
turn serve as inputs to other HSDIV output clocks. These clocks use
the actual value to compute the divider clock rate, and need to be
registered with the CLK_DIVIDER_ONE_BASED flags. The current k3-clk
driver and data lacks the infrastructure to pass in divider flags.
Update the driver and data to account for these divider flags.

We are not guaranteed to have the padding_pkcs_15_verify symbol since
commit 92c960bc1d ("lib: rsa: Remove #ifdefs from rsa.h"), and
commit 61416fe9df ("Kconfig: FIT_SIGNATURE should not select RSA_VERIFY")
The padding_algos only make sense with RSA verification, which can now
be disabled in lieu of ECDSA. In fact this will lead to build failures
because of the missing symbol mentioned earlier.
To resolve this, move the padding_algos to a linker list, with
declarations moved to rsa_verify.c. This is consistent with commit
6909edb4ce ("image: rsa: Move verification algorithm to a linker list")
One could argue that the added #ifdef USE_HOSTCC is ugly, and should
be hidden within the U_BOOT_PADDING_ALGO() macro. However, this would
be inconsistent with the "cryptos" list. This logic for was not
previously explored:
Without knowledge of the U_BOOT_PADDING_ALGO() macro, its use is
similar to something being declared. However, should #ifndef
USE_HOSTCC be part of the macro, it would not be obvious that it
behaves differently on host code and target code. Having the #ifndef
outside the macro makes this obvious.
Also, the #ifdef is not always necessary. For example ecda-verify
makes use of U_BOOT_CRYPTO_ALGO() without any accompanying #ifdefs.
The fundamental issue is a lack of separation of host and target code
in rsa_verify. Therefore, the declaration of a padding algo with the
external #ifdef is more readable and consistent.
